MINOT, N.D. (NewsDakota.com) – The Norsk Høstfest is please to announce that we will be welcoming Norwegian Ambassador Anniken Huitfeldt to our festivities. The Ambassador arrives in Minot on Tuesday, September 23rd.

The Scandinavian Heritage Association is welcoming her to the Magic City with a personal tour of the Scandinavian Heritage Park. Later, she’ll get to spend time with North Dakota’s First Lady (and fellow Norwegian!) Kjersti Armstrong. In the evening, Ambassador Huitfeldt joins us for the Høstfest Governor’s Reception.

On Wednesday September 24th, the first day of Høstfest, Ambassador Huitfeldt will be a distinguished guest at the Bunad Show, taking place at 11am in Oslo Hall. She’ll also attend the Opening Ceremony at 2:30pm in the Great Hall – which is free and open to all festivalgoers! The Høstfest is thrilled to welcome Norwegian Ambassador Anniken Huitfeldt to our 46th annual festival, which runs from September 24th – 27th at the North Dakota State Fair Center in Minot.

The Høstfest’s four-day slate of Great Hall entertainers are Bjøro Håland, The Killer Vees Neil Diamond Tribute, Abbacadabra, Cash vs. The King: an Elvis Presley & Johnny Cash Tribute Presented by Medora (back to back shows!), and Little Texas. Side stage entertainers include Brian Sklar & The Western Senators, Fiddling Lefty, Midwest Murder Podcast, Waddington Brothers, Moon Cats, and Project Constellation, along with many others.
